The release of The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time (1998) revolutionized the series' approach to character relationships. By introducing a narrative that spanned seven years of childhood and adulthood, the game presented Link with a complex web of interpersonal connections, effectively launching the franchise's vibrant "shipping" culture.

In the original The Legend of Zelda (1986) and Zelda II: The Adventure of Link (1987), the dynamic between Link and Princess Zelda followed the traditional fairy-tale blueprint. Zelda was the damsel in distress; Link was the courageous knight. The romantic implication was purely transactional by modern standards, culminating in a literal curtain drop and a implied kiss at the end of Zelda II . Ocarina of Time introduced Saria, Link’s Kokiri childhood friend. Their bond is established early on through music—Saria’s Song—and a poignant parting scene where she gifts Link his first ocarina. The tragedy of their relationship lies in Link's destiny: he grows up into an adult, while Saria, as a Kokiri and later a Sage, remains frozen in childhood, forever separating them.
